In Sri Lanka, as economic crisis worsens, two men die waiting in queue for fuel

Sri Lanka Colombo fuel queue

Colombo, Sri LankaReuters Sri Lankan police said on Sunday two men collapsed and died while waiting in separate queues to secure fuel amid sky-rocketing prices leading to record inflation. Biden administration rules Myanmar army committed genocide against Rohingya

Bangladesh Bhasan Char Rohingya refugees

Washington DC, USReuters The Biden administration has formally determined that violence committed against the Rohingya minority by Myanmar’s military amounts to genocide and crimes against humanity, US officials told Reuters, a move that advocates say should bolster efforts to hold the junta that now runs Myanmar accountable. Pope rules baptised lay Catholics, including women, can lead Vatican departments

Vatiican Pope Italian lay woman Francesca Di Giovanni

Vatican CityReuters Pope Francis introduced a landmark reform on Saturday that will allow any baptised lay Catholic, including women, to head most Vatican departments under a new constitution for the Holy See’s central administration.
